Dynamite Shrimp Recipe

Description

This Dynamite Shrimp recipe features crispy, fried shrimp coated in a tangy, spicy, and creamy sauce made from mayonnaise, sriracha, honey, lime juice, and soy sauce. Perfect as an appetizer or served over rice or salad, this dish combines bold flavors with a satisfying crunch in just 30 minutes.


Ingredients

Scale

Shrimp and Coating

  • 1 lb large shrimp, peeled and deveined
  • 1/2 cup buttermilk
  • 1/2 cup all-purpose flour
  • 1/2 cup cornstarch
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1/2 teaspoon black pepper
  • Oil for frying (vegetable or canola oil preferred)

Sauce

  • 1/2 cup mayonnaise
  • 2 tablespoons sriracha sauce
  • 1 tablespoon honey
  • 1 tablespoon lime juice
  • 1 teaspoon soy sauce

Garnish

  • Chopped green onions
  • Sesame seeds


Instructions

  1. Prepare the Shrimp: Marinate the peeled and deveined shrimp in buttermilk for 15 to 20 minutes to tenderize and add moisture.
  2. Mix Dry Ingredients: In a separate bowl, combine all-purpose flour, cornstarch, salt, and black pepper to create the coating mixture.
  3. Heat Oil: Preheat oil in a deep skillet or fryer to 350°F (175°C), ensuring enough oil to deep fry the shrimp evenly.
  4. Fry the Shrimp: Remove shrimp from the buttermilk marinade, dredge thoroughly in the flour mixture, and carefully fry the shrimp in batches for about 2 to 3 minutes per side until golden brown and crispy. Drain on paper towels to remove excess oil.
  5. Prepare the Sauce: In a bowl, whisk together mayonnaise, sriracha sauce, honey, lime juice, and soy sauce until the sauce is completely smooth and well blended.
  6. Assemble the Dish: Toss the crispy fried shrimp with the spicy mayonnaise sauce in a large bowl, coating each shrimp evenly.
  7. Garnish: Sprinkle chopped green onions and sesame seeds over the sauced shrimp for a fresh, nutty finish.
  8. Serve: Serve the Dynamite Shrimp immediately, either as a flavorful appetizer or accompanied by rice or salad for a complete meal.

Notes

  • Ensure the oil temperature is maintained at 350°F to achieve a crispy exterior without absorbing too much oil.
  • Marinating the shrimp in buttermilk helps keep them tender and juicy after frying.
  • For extra crunch, double dredge the shrimp by dipping them again in the buttermilk and flour mixture.
  • Adjust the sriracha sauce in the sauce to control the heat level to your preference.
  • This dish is best served immediately to enjoy the shrimp’s crispiness.
